it all began in a garden. Founder and CEO Michael Heinrich was in his grandmother’s garden in Germany when he learned about the power of food. An avid gardener and medical doctor, his grandmother taught him how to use food to fuel his mind and body. Michael initially pushed the lessons to the back of his thoughts as he began a career in finance. Quickly he discovered corporate culture prizes productivity over health. Michael found this perspective flawed, remembered his grandmother’s advice and put his own healthful ideas into practice. They worked. Research has since proven that health and productivity go hand in hand, and the more healthful foods people consume during the day, the happier, more engaged, and creative they become. Supported with research, nutritionists, chefs and a mission, Michael founded Oh My Green. Healthful food became the foundation of our company, just as it’s the foundation for growth, creativity, productivity and happiness in our work and lives. Today that mission has expanded to bring in wellbeing through meditation, mindfulness and community events. And Oh My Green is now garten, the German word for “garden.”
